Welcome to the OU SAVITSKY HOME RELOCATION FAIR – Since 2008, the Orthodox Union has been providing resources to assist families, young couples, retirees, and singles looking to relocate to another community. This event will be virtual, and you can participate from the comfort of your own home to “visit” and connect with representatives of over 60 communities from 23 states and provinces from North America and Israel.
